8 month DD has really bad nappy rash - any ideas

34 replies

doodleboo · 24/01/2009 20:46

DD is 8 months and has suddenly got really bad nappy rash over the course of the day - at the last change it started bleeding in one place.

She is a cheerful thing and not whinging about it but it looks so sore.

I have been putting sudocrem on at each nappy change, she's had a bath to make sure it's clean, and a couple of hours without a nappy altogether.

She's currently in a muslin with her cotton vest done up over the top (no nappy).

Any other suggestions? She's walking round the furniture and crawling at high speed so it's difficult (and slippery!) for her to go without anything at all downstairs.

Also could it be anything else - is there any infection she could have got that's making it worse? DS has had nappy rash a fair few times now but never this bad.
